CVE-2025-71247 has been rejected by its CVE Numbering Authority (CNA). This means the vulnerability identifier is no longer valid and should not be referenced in security advisories, vulnerability management systems, or compliance reports.
CVE rejections typically occur for several reasons:
- The reported issue was determined not to be a security vulnerability
- The CVE was a duplicate of an existing identifier
- The vulnerability report could not be verified
- The affected software or vendor was incorrectly identified
- The original reporter withdrew the submission
Organizations that may have previously tracked this CVE should remove it from their vulnerability management workflows.
